What is Basswood?

Basswood, also known as the American Linden tree, is derived from the basswood tree, which is common to North America. This wood is famous for being lightweight, soft, and easy to work with, making it perfect for carving and turning but also for producing the best musical instruments.

Its pale, uniform grain and low resin content give it a clean physical appearance, and it absorbs paint, stains, and finishes properly. Basswood instruments, especially electrical guitars, are popular among beginning and advanced musicians due to their tonal characteristics and low cost.

Why Use Basswood for Guitars?

Basswood in musical instruments, mainly electric guitars. Many luthiers prefer basswood guitar bodies due to its constant performance, lightweight design, and tonal balance.

Key Benefits of a Basswood Guitar Body:

  • Lightweight: Basswood guitars are comparatively light weight than other wood guitars, making it more comfortable for extended performances or practice sessions.

  • Warm Tonal Response: Basswood produces a balanced tone with strong mid-range and a smooth response. It lacks the brightness of maple and the low-end punch of mahogany, but it produces a well-balanced tone suitable for a variety of genres.

  • Easy to Shape and Finish: Basswood guitar body blanks are easy to work with because of their soft nature. It also absorbs paint and finishes very well, which is perfect for personalized guitars.

  • Affordable Yet Functional: Basswood has low cost and better performance, perfect for both beginner and experienced luthiers to manufacture high-quality instruments in less effort.

Ideal for Electric Guitars

If you're making an electric guitar, basswood guitar body blanks are a great option. The tonewood works very well with pickups and amplifiers, providing the player to shape the tone using electronics rather than depending exclusively on the wood's natural resonance.

Famous brands frequently use basswood guitar bodies for their popular guitar models due to its reliability and tonal neutrality. These qualities make basswood musical instruments ideal for musicians who want to customize their sound using pedals, amplifiers, or pickup adjustments.

Considerations for Acoustic Instruments

Basswood is most frequently used with electric guitars, but it is also used in acoustic guitars, ukuleles, and stringed folk musical instruments. However, due to its lower resonance compared to standard acoustic tonewoods, it is not a popular choice for high-end acoustic guitar tonewoods, compared to spruce or rosewood.

For beginner level guitarists and luthiers basswood can still be a practical and affordable option. Its smooth grain is also a good choice for decorative inlays.

Other Basswood Musical Instrument Applications

Beyond guitars, basswood musical instruments can include:

  • Ukuleles: Lightweight and reasonable price, ideal for entry-level builds.

  • Violins or Violas: Less common but useful for prototypes or beginner models.

  • Percussion Instruments: Basswood shells are ideal for hand drums or practice pads due to their softness and control.
